There are approximately 80,000 chemicals registered for use in the U.S.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ention reports that hundreds of these chemicals are present in our bodies. The simple truth is, we are surrounded by toxins. In fact, we are exposed to more environmental toxins in one day than our grandparents were in an entire lifetime.
​
We are talking about toxicants that come in the way of the personal care products we use, like shampoos, laundry detergents, skin care. As well as, those that come from the material we use to cook and store our foods, pesticides, mold and EMF exposure. Additionally, these toxicants reside on our furniture, and our building materials. It seems like toxicants are everywhere.
​
These exposures are not acute. Meaning we ingest or get exposed to a high dose at one time, rather its a chronic long-term exposure that builds up and can create havoc in our system.
​
For over 30 years,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ention has been looking for and finding chemicals in the US population and tracking them in their long-running biomonitoring studies. They have measured over 400 different chemicals inside us.
In 2005, the Environmental Working Group took this biomonitoring a step further by testing the umbilical cord blood of 10 newborn babies and shockingly, but not surprisingly, finding a total of 287 chemicals including carcinogens, neurotoxins, developmental toxins and others. Some Biomedical Functional Tests that are assess our internal toxicants are::
​
Hair Minerals & Metals - Many have a hard time detoxing heavy metals from their environment. Hair can give us a reliable representation of heavy metal burden and minerals. The hair shows a three-month window of what has been going on in the body.
​
Environmental Toxin Panel - We live in a toxic world! Toxins from plastic bottles, food containers, air pollution, contaminated water, non-organic produce, and other unhealthy contaminants can build up in the body and exacerbate hormone, weight and mood issues. Via a simple urine test we can measure the buildup of these toxins in the body and make lifestyle changes to help the body naturally detox or use diet/supplements to help bind and excrete toxins.
Organic Acid Test (OAT) or a Myco-TOX- The Organic Acids Test (OAT) is considered a “metabolic snapshot” of what is going on in the body. It provides information on important neurotransmitters, nutritional markers, glutathione status, oxalate metabolism, evaluation of intestinal yeast and bacteria, and much more. The test includes 74 urinary metabolite markers that can be very useful for discovering underlying causes of chronic illness.
​
Glyphosate Test - Recent studies have discovered glyphosate exposure to be a cause of many chronic health problems. It can enter the body by direct absorption through the skin, by eating foods treated with glyphosate, or by drinking water contaminated with glyphosate.
